The Effect of Temperature Level on Paint Application



When you're planning an industrial external painting project, the temperature can substantially affect exactly how well the paint sticks and dries out.

Preferably, you intend to paint when temperatures vary in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's as well cool, the paint may not treat effectively, causing concerns like peeling off or splitting.

On the other hand, if it's as well warm, the paint can dry out as well promptly, stopping correct bond and causing an irregular finish.

You must additionally consider the moment of day; early morning or late afternoon uses cooler temperature levels, which can be a lot more favorable.

Always check the supplier's referrals for the certain paint you're using, as they commonly offer assistance on the perfect temperature range for ideal results.

Moisture and Its Impact on Drying Times



Temperature level isn't the only ecological aspect that affects your business exterior painting project; humidity plays a considerable role too. High humidity degrees can decrease drying out times substantially, impacting the overall top quality of your paint work.



When the air is filled with moisture, the paint takes longer to cure, which can result in concerns like bad attachment and a greater threat of mildew development. If you're repainting on a specifically moist day, be planned for prolonged wait times between layers.

It's important to check local weather and plan accordingly. Ideally, go for humidity degrees in between 40% and 70% for optimum drying out.
